ASP.NET中如何循环处理ID号连续的文本框

问题描述

我在页面上添加几个复选框和几个文本框,它们之间是一一对应的,现在就是希望在页面加载时这几个文本框都是不可用的,一旦对应的复选框被选中,则该文本框变为可用,最后还要将几个文本框中输入的值都取出并相加(文本框中输入的是整型数据)。

解决方案

解决方案二:
this.FindControl("ID")asTextBox写在for循环里拼ID就行了。
解决方案三:
能不能说的明白点,我是菜鸟级别的引用1楼的回复:

this.FindControl("ID")asTextBox写在for循环里拼ID就行了。

解决方案四:
比如你的TextBox的ID为TextBox1、TextBox2、TextBox3,那么可以用:for(inti=1;i<=3;i++){TextBoxtb=this.FindControl("TextBox"+i)asTextBox;//处理tb;}

时间: 2024-10-12 06:11:33

ASP.NET中如何循环处理ID号连续的文本框的相关文章

javascript-在Javascript中如何实现在dt列表后面添加文本框

问题描述 在Javascript中如何实现在dt列表后面添加文本框 解决方案 document.getElementById(""那个td的id"").innerHTML+=' '; 解决方案二: 不能再创建一个 input,然后再appendChild吗?

js行号显示的文本框实现效果(兼容多种浏览器 )_javascript技巧

利用js打造的一个非常实用简易的文本编辑框,可以显示行号并且同时兼容ie和firefox等主流浏览器,如下效果图: 以下是该效果的源码: <html> <head> <meta http-equiv="Content-Type" content="text/html;charset=utf-8"> <title>显示行号的文本框效果,兼容ie.火狐等浏览器</title> <style type=&q

网页-【50块求解决个小问题】用webbrowser赋值没有ID和NAME的文本框然后可以提交

问题描述 [50块求解决个小问题]用webbrowser赋值没有ID和NAME的文本框然后可以提交 要怎么样才可以赋值没有ID和name的文本框框呢?网页代码就是上面那个 QQ896351151 解决方案 没有name,id的话就要class来找节点. 解决方案二: 通过getElementsByTagName能找到这个节点吗?能判断出这个节点吗 解决方案三: 没有id可以借助已知id的最近元素的child parent next定位. 解决方案四: 网页的内容

link中如何点一个按钮删除一次文本框,再点一次再删除一个。

问题描述 link中如何点一个按钮删除一次文本框,再点一次再删除一个. link中如何点一个按钮删除一次文本框,再点一次再删除一个. 解决方案 Controls.Remove[Controls["控件名"]]

extbox背景色-ASP.NET 开发网页时如何动态的设这文本框的背景颜色?

问题描述 ASP.NET 开发网页时如何动态的设这文本框的背景颜色? 毕业设计要求做一个色彩展示的页面,需要从数据库挑出颜色代码,然后在网页来设置一个TextBox的背景色,该怎么做呢?

在点击dataGridview 控件中的数据时,如何显示在文本框中?

问题描述 在点击dataGridview控件中的数据时,如何显示在文本框中? 解决方案 解决方案二:在cellclik事件中把只取出来传给TextBox就行了privatevoiddataGridView1_CellClick(objectsender,DataGridViewCellEventArgse){TextBox1.Text=this.dataGridView1.Rows[1].Cells[1].Value.ToString().Trim();} 解决方案三:privatevoidda

asp.net中for循环语句的用法介绍

for循环的格式为: for([初始化表达式];[条件表达式];[迭代表达式 ]) {           //语句块 } 其中:[初始化表达式];[条件表达式];[迭代表达式 ]都是可选的,[条件表达式]必须是一个布尔表达式. 执行步骤为: 第一步:开始执行初始化表达式,只执行一次. 第二步:开始执行条件表达式(若为空,则返回true),若为true,则执行大括号中的语句:若为false,则直接跳到for的结束点. 第三步:开始执行迭代表达式+条件表达式. 第四步:若条件表达式为true,则执

asp.net textbox javascript实现enter与ctrl+enter互换 文本框发送消息与换行(类似于QQ)_实用技巧

1.也许讲解有点初级,希望高手不要"喷"我,因为我知道并不是每一个人都是高手,我也怕高手们说我装13: 2.如有什么不对的地方,还希望大家指出,一定虚心学习,如果有更好的办法请告诉我一声哦: 3.本文属于作者原创,尊重他人劳动成果,转载请注明作者,谢谢. 下面开讲: 如题,这个功能也困扰了我一两天事件了,我也上网找了很多资料,但是网上大部分的说法都差不多,问题始终还是没解决,于是乎我开始找是问题的根源,我开始用的是文本框的onkeydown事件,分别写了两个js函数,如下: 复制代码

ASP.NET中让同一个页面不同的文本框回车响应不同的事件

asp.net|文本框|响应|页面 在ASP.NET中,如果同一页面有多个文本框,在每个文本框按"回车"按钮,将会默认响应第一个Button的Click事件,怎样能随意的按回车键而不引发意外的响应或者怎样在不同的地方按回车键得到不同的响应,这个问题曾经困扰过我很久,到目前也没有完全解决,先将目前探讨所得与大家分享,以期抛砖引玉.一.在页面任意的地方按回车键都不引发响应    如果整个页面没有需要设置回车提交的,希望在页面任意的地方按回车键都不引发响应,可以将全页面的回车通通转为Tab,